**Job Description**
We are seeking a Warehouse Driver with experience in delivery, driving, and warehouse operations. In this role, you will use material handling equipment such as forklifts to unload shipments, place them in the warehouse, pull orders for customers, and ensure order accuracy. You will also handle a variety of tasks including driving a Class C vehicle, performing local deliveries, and providing excellent customer service.
**Responsibilities**
+ Operate forklifts to unload shipments from vendors and place them in the warehouse.
+ Pull and prepare orders for customers, ensuring accuracy.
+ Drive a Class C vehicle for route deliveries.
+ Load and unload a 20-foot box truck using pallet jacks and rigging clamps.
+ Perform pre-trip inspections to ensure vehicle safety.
+ Provide excellent customer service during deliveries.
+ Maintain a clean and organized warehouse.
**Essential Skills**
+ Experience in forklift operation and warehouse management.
+ Ability to drive a Class C vehicle for local deliveries.
+ Proficiency in loading and unloading trucks using pallet jacks and rigging clamps.
+ Strong customer service skills.
+ Ability to perform pre-trip inspections.
**Additional Skills & Qualifications**
+ At least 2 years of route driving experience.
+ Customer service attitude.
+ Warehouse experience.
+ No more than 2 moving violations in the last 3 years.
+ Ability to produce a DMV report.
+ Ability to lift 75 lbs and handle 100 lbs.
+ Strong English communication skills.
